About
🌴✨ Outdoor art walk. Avenida del Mar links Alameda Park to the seafront through a marble promenade lined with ten original bronze sculptures by Salvador Dalí, framed by fountains and palm trees. 🎉🎶 Cultural hotspot. During Marbella’s San Bernabé Fair, the avenue becomes a main stage for live shows, concerts and festivities. Throughout the year, it also hosts craft markets, music events and food fairs in the open air. 🗿🚶 Free open‑air museum. The Verona‑cast sculptures are arranged in a public setting, accessible 24/7, perfect for strolling, relaxing or capturing the golden hour on camera. 🌊📍 Key city connector. A strategic passage between the Old Town and the sea, Avenida del Mar is a living space for culture, creativity and community all year long.
